
Days of the Presidential Library held at the Tyumen Institute for Advanced Studies of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Russia
The Days of the Presidential Library were held on March 28-29, 2022 within the framework of the plan of joint events of the branch of the Presidential Library in Tyumen Region and the "Tyumen Institute for Advanced Training of Employees of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of the Russian Federation" for the 2021/2022 academic year.
The video film The Second World War in Archival Documents presented by the Presidential Library aroused particular interest among the round table participants.
The study of previously classified documents, historical facts, correspondence of senior officials that left their mark on Russian and Soviet history was based on the preparation of police essays on various topics in the nominations “The history of the Russian police”, “Following the pages of the history of victory in the Great Patriotic War 1941-1945" and “Patriotism Through the Ages”. The listeners examined their research in studying the significance of the role of Alexander Nevsky and Dmitry Donskoy, Mikhail Tukhachevsky and Kliment Voroshilov in the history of the Russian state.
Summing up the results of the contest of students' works using the Presidential Library’s sources, the head of the library of the "TIPC of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Russia", candidate of legal sciences Tatyana Silina noted that interaction with the Presidential Library allows to successfully implement scientific and educational projects. Archival documents about the history of the organization of police activities stored in the Presidential Library are widely used by specialists in the educational process and moral building.
